hey everyone, first off i apologize if this has been asked before. i'm just curious as to how tight everyone runs their slipper clutch? i'm running the stock 2 speed tranny on my x 4.6. when i had the 3 speed in there i ate threw spur gears and slipper's like there was no tomorrow, could never find the balance.
the manual says once its tight enough, you should be able to spin the spur with a lot of effort, but i find that's too lose due to wear and the power of the engine. but i'm hesitant to go too tight, cause i like to jump my truck. i'm good at getting off the gas on landings, or at least easing up on the throttle a good deal. i obviously notice the truck picks up and runs much better the tighter it is, i just don't want to wear out the slipper or the spur after a run. just looking for a little advice and wondering how others here do it.
